4 /*
5  * Start of day structure passed to PVH guests and to HVM guests in %ebx.
6  *
7  * NOTE: nothing will be loaded at physical address 0, so a 0 value in any
8  * of the address fields should be treated as not present.
9  *
10  * 0 +----------------+
11  * | magic | Contains the magic value XEN_HVM_START_MAGIC_VALUE
12  * | | ("xEn3" with the 0x80 bit of the "E" set).
13  * 4 +----------------+
14  * | version | Version of this structure. Current version is 0. New
15  * | | versions are guaranteed to be backwards-compatible.
16  * 8 +----------------+
17  * | flags | SIF_xxx flags.
18  * 12 +----------------+
19  * | nr_modules | Number of modules passed to the kernel.
20  * 16 +----------------+
21  * | modlist_paddr | Physical address of an array of modules
22  * | | (layout of the structure below).
23  * 24 +----------------+
24  * | cmdline_paddr | Physical address of the command line,
25  * | | a zero-terminated ASCII string.
26  * 32 +----------------+
27  * | rsdp_paddr | Physical address of the RSDP ACPI data structure.
28  * 40 +----------------+
29  *
30  * The layout of each entry in the module structure is the following:
31  *
32  * 0 +----------------+
33  * | paddr | Physical address of the module.
34  * 8 +----------------+
35  * | size | Size of the module in bytes.
36  * 16 +----------------+
37  * | cmdline_paddr | Physical address of the command line,
38  * | | a zero-terminated ASCII string.
39  * 24 +----------------+
40  * | reserved |
41  * 32 +----------------+
42  *
43  * The address and sizes are always a 64bit little endian unsigned integer.
44  *
45  * NB: Xen on x86 will always try to place all the data below the 4GiB
46  * boundary.
47  */
